Poor Product Choice
When it pertains to roof covering setup, picking the wrong materials can result in expensive issues down the line. You might assume that any type of roofing material will do, but that's a common false impression. It's critical to pick products that suit your local environment and the specific demands of your home.
For instance, if you stay in an area with hefty rainfall or snow, opting for asphalt tiles might not be the best selection. Rather, consider even more sturdy options like metal or slate.
In addition, take notice of the top quality of the materials you're thinking about. Inexpensive materials might conserve you cash upfront, however they often lack durability and can cause regular fixings or substitutes.
You should additionally consider the design of your home and make sure the materials you select will certainly maintain its visual charm.
Lastly, don't neglect to speak with experts. They can give beneficial insights and suggest materials that abide by local building regulations.
Investing time in proper product choice now can assist you stay clear of frustrations and expenses in the future, making your roofing job a success.
Inadequate Flashing Installment
Selecting the appropriate products isn't the only element that can lead to roof troubles; inadequate blinking installment can likewise develop significant concerns. Flashing is essential for routing water far from vulnerable areas, such as chimneys, skylights, and roofing valleys. If it's not mounted appropriately, you risk water invasion, which can cause mold development and architectural damage.
When you set up blinking, ensure it's the best type for your roofing's style and the neighborhood environment. As an example, metal blinking is frequently more resilient than plastic in areas with hefty rainfall or snow. Make sure the flashing overlaps properly and is secured firmly to prevent gaps where water can permeate with.
You must additionally take note of the installation angle. Blinking must be placed to route water far from your home, not toward it.
If you're unclear about the installment process or the materials needed, seek advice from an expert. They can help recognize the most effective flashing options and ensure everything is installed appropriately, securing your home from prospective water damage.

Neglecting Ventilation Needs
While numerous property owners concentrate on the visual and structural facets of roof installation, disregarding air flow requirements can result in severe long-lasting repercussions. Proper air flow is important for controling temperature and moisture degrees in your attic, stopping concerns like mold and mildew growth, timber rot, and ice dams. If you don't install sufficient ventilation, you're establishing your roof covering up for failing.
To avoid this error, first, analyze your home's specific ventilation requirements. A balanced system typically consists of both consumption and exhaust vents to advertise air flow. Ensure you've mounted so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the optimal of your roofing system. This mix enables hot air to escape while cooler air gets in, maintaining your attic room space comfortable.
Likewise, think about the type of roof covering product you have actually picked. Some products may need extra air flow techniques. Verify your local building regulations for air flow standards, as they can differ dramatically.
Finally, don't fail to remember to inspect your air flow system regularly. Blockages from debris or insulation can restrain air movement, so keep those vents clear.
